Position Summary

Cast Members aboard The Polar Express Train RideTM are responsible for the entertainment of guests for a 55 min show performing 3 shows per night over the course of the season. Chefs and stewards are the face of the show for each train car, working in pairs to entertain the guests. Elves are the Dancers at the North Pole for when the train arrives. Hero Kid has integral moments at the beginning and end of each show. Cast Members must be high energy and have the ability to perform multiple shows per night. Cast Members may also be required to fill other roles as needed.
